Why Does Pregnancy Cause Morning Sickness?

Nausea and vomiting of pregnancy (NVP) is most closely linked to the rapid rise in hCG (human chorionic gonadotropin) and oestrogen during the first trimester. These hormonal shifts are also thought to heighten sensitivity to smell and taste, which is why certain foods or scents can trigger symptoms almost instantly. For most women, symptoms peak around weeks 9–10 and ease by weeks 16–20, though a smaller number experience nausea for longer, and a small percentage develop a more severe form called Hyperemesis Gravidarum (HG).

Why Are Electrolytes Important for Pregnancy Nausea?

Electrolytes, primarily sodium, potassium and chloride, regulate fluid balance, nerve signalling and muscle function throughout the body. Repeated vomiting depletes these minerals faster than they can be replaced through food and water alone, which can lead to dehydration and, in more severe cases, contribute to the electrolyte and fluid disturbances seen in Hyperemesis Gravidarum (HG). Clinical literature on HG consistently identifies electrolyte and fluid replacement as a core part of managing moderate to severe nausea and vomiting in pregnancy, alongside dietary and medical support. This is part of why hydration-focused, electrolyte-based support has become a common recommendation for women experiencing frequent morning sickness, it addresses a real physiological loss, not just the symptom of feeling unwell.

Is Ginger Safe and Effective for Morning Sickness?

Ginger is one of the most studied natural remedies for nausea and vomiting of pregnancy. A 2014 meta-analysis published in the Journal of the American Board of Family Medicine pooled multiple randomized controlled trials and found ginger supplementation was associated with a reduction in nausea severity compared with placebo. Earlier systematic reviews and RCTs, including a widely cited 2004 trial, report similar findings. Researchers believe ginger's bioactive compounds (gingerols and shogaols) may influence gastric motility and interact with pathways involved in the nausea response, though the exact mechanism is still being studied.

On safety, existing reviews generally regard ginger as well-tolerated in pregnancy at the doses used in most clinical trials (commonly around 1g per day, in divided doses). Evidence on higher doses is more limited, which is why it's worth discussing ginger supplementation with a midwife, GP or obstetrician, particularly in early pregnancy.
